Abstract : Eye-tracking technology has become increasingly popular in various fields such as psychology, human-computer interaction, and market research. However, the process of converting raw eye-tracking data into a usable format for analysis can be complex and time-consuming. This abstract proposes a novel approach to streamline this process by leveraging cloud computing and the Faster R-CNN (FRCNN) algorithm. The proposed method involves three key steps: data preprocessing, cloud-based processing, and FRCNN-based analysis. Cloud computing provides the necessary computational power and storage capabilities to handle large datasets and perform resource-intensive tasks. Finally, the preprocessed eye-tracking data is fed into an FRCNN model for advanced analysis and interpretation. The proposed approach offers several advantages over traditional methods. Firstly, it reduces the burden of data preprocessing by automating the cleaning and formatting tasks. Secondly, the scalability and flexibility of cloud computing enable researchers to analyse large datasets efficiently. Lastly, the integration of FRCNN enhances the analysis capabilities by providing accurate and detailed information about eye movements.
